You searched for a roofing contractor or roofing company that offers commerical services. Click on one of the results below to view more detailed information.
3 Results
JCS Roofing Services banner
Dn26pn
JCS Roofing Services avatar

14 Montrose avenue , Doncaster, Doncaster Dn26pn

JCS Roofing Services banner
Dn26pn
JCS Roofing Services avatar

14 Montrose avenue , Doncaster, Doncaster Dn26pn

CW Roofing and Building banner
DN9 3BD

Page: |